                In a related issue, there was a former KGMBer (not ku'u) who went to San Diego years back to anchor and report at the WB station there. Whatever happened to Dave Carlin?

                And since we're on the subject, what's the list of former Honolulu tv alum hitting mainland airwaves now? There's Teri Okita, Emily Chang, weather girls Ku'u and Maria Quiban, Neil Everett, Dave Carlin, Nancy Wiener (forget what her married name is now but she's on ABC national news a lot) and another girl from KHON, forget her name but she's in Salt Lake now. Fujii or something. And that's just the names I can think of off the top of my head. I think there's a couple more guys, Cedric Moon and Will Tran as well, both former KGMBers. Oh and Ross Shimabuku is the main sports anchor in Phoenix, AZ.

                Wow, lots nowadays. Walt will have plenty of company at least.
